Output 3ae675b43f11f6c75d484255ffc68d7d5c42e842ae04fa699b06ccb0a86757c4:6

value
436943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9da93fc4b2c08cdb05c560fce1fd64f983c7ee6 OP_EQUAL
address
3HB7y2u5EcNqMDmaZDCLNBgbcAA9RRHuCS
transaction
3ae675b43f11f6c75d484255ffc68d7d5c42e842ae04fa699b06ccb0a86757c4
spent
true